Abstract

The utility model discloses an ecological protection slope, which belongs to the technical field of ecological protection slopes and comprises a soil base layer and a protection slope body, wherein the inner structure of the protection slope body is arranged as two layers, the inner layer is arranged as a coarse sand layer, the outer layer is arranged as a concrete brick layer, the protection slope body comprises a first slope and a second slope, the upper side of the first slope is connected with an upper platform, the lower side of the second slope is connected with a lower platform, a buffer platform is arranged between the first slope and the second slope, the upper platform is provided with an upper protection belt, the lower platform is provided with a lower protection belt, the buffer platform is provided with a stable protection belt, tree planting pits are respectively arranged on the upper platform, the lower platform and the buffer platform, coarse stones are filled in the tree planting pits, and planting holes are formed in the splicing position of the concrete brick layer.

Background
The ecological protection slope is a protection device arranged on a river channel or a hillside and is used for maintaining a protection structure of the current soil topography, and the land landslide is avoided, so that the change of the topography is caused, and the influence is further realized. Current ecological protection slope combines concrete formation bank protection area often to use massive stone, only plants in the top or the below in bank protection area, plays corresponding protective effect, but does not have corresponding good gas permeability and water permeability, consequently leads to ecological environment to receive the influence necessarily, leads to the bank protection effect to weaken then, can not satisfy people's user demand, has consequently highlighted an ecological protection slope.
Disclosure of Invention
The utility model aims to provide an ecological protection slope, which improves the protection effect of a protection slope body on a soil base layer by arranging two sections of gentle slopes, and solves the problems in background materials by arranging a concrete brick layer capable of water seepage and planting holes so that the soil base layer has good air permeability and water seepage.
In order to achieve the above purpose, the utility model provides an ecological protection slope, which comprises a soil base layer and a protection slope body, wherein the inner structure of the protection slope body is provided with two layers, the inner layer is provided with a coarse sand layer, the outer layer is provided with a concrete brick layer, the protection slope body comprises a first slope and a second slope, the upper side of the first slope is connected with an upper platform, the lower side of the second slope is connected with a lower platform, a buffer platform is arranged between the first slope and the second slope, an upper protection belt is arranged on the upper platform, a lower protection belt is arranged on the lower platform, a stable protection belt is arranged on the buffer platform, tree planting pits are arranged on the upper platform, the lower platform and the buffer platform, coarse stones are filled in the tree planting pits, and planting holes are formed at the splicing positions of the concrete brick layers.
Preferably, the particle diameter in the coarse sand layer is 1-4mm, and the thickness of the coarse sand layer is 2-5cm.
The coarse sand layer can effectively drain accumulated water and can guide excessive accumulated water to the lower platform.
Preferably, vine plants are planted in the planting holes on the first slope and the second slope.
The vine plants can climb on the slope, so that the concrete brick layer is protected, and the greening effect is better.
Preferably, the tree plants and the shrubs are planted in the upper guard band, the tree plants, the herbs and the shrubs are planted in the stable guard band, and the tree plants and the herbs are planted in the lower guard band.
According to the characteristic that water is from high to low, the shrub plants are planted in places with high topography, water can be reserved, and the herbaceous plants are planted in places with low topography, so that the water evaporation is fast, and the water circulation is facilitated.
Preferably, the materials of the concrete bricks in the concrete brick layer are water seepage concrete, and the concrete bricks are in an octagonal structure.
Preferably, the concrete brick is provided with a diversion trench.
Therefore, the ecological protection slope adopting the structure has the following beneficial effects:
(1) In the utility model, two slopes and buffer platforms are constructed, and different plant types are designed according to the topography, so that the damage of moisture to the soil base layer is reduced, and the stability of the whole structure is improved.
(2) In the utility model, the water seepage concrete brick layer is arranged, so that the water seepage property and air permeability of the protective slope body are ensured, and the normal ecology in the soil base layer is ensured.
(3) In the utility model, the coarse sand layer is arranged and can be used as a water conveying channel, and the root system of the plant can be protected, so that the plant can take root downwards, the soil and water of the soil base layer are stabilized, the hollow structure is reduced, and collapse is avoided.
(4) In the utility model, the planting holes are arranged in the concrete brick layer, plants can be planted through the planting holes, the greening effect is improved, and meanwhile, water can be rapidly drained, so that the soil structure of the planting holes is stabilized.

As shown in fig. 1-2, the utility model provides an ecological protection slope, comprising a soil base layer 1 and a protection slope body, wherein the inner structure of the protection slope body is provided with two layers, the inner layer is provided with a coarse sand layer 2, the particle diameter in the coarse sand layer 2 is 1-4mm, the thickness of the coarse sand layer 2 is 2-5cm, the coarse sand layer 2 is provided for manufacturing a water flow channel inside, when facing heavy rain weather, accumulated water can be quickly permeated downwards or conveyed downwards along a slope through the coarse sand layer 2, the outer layer is provided with a concrete brick layer 3, the concrete brick layer 3 has enough strength to ensure that the surface structure can be maintained, the protection slope body comprises a first slope 5 and a second slope 7, the upper side of the first slope 5 is connected with an upper platform 4, the lower side of the second slope 7 is connected with a lower platform 8, a buffer platform 6 is arranged between the first slope 5 and the second slope 7, the buffer platform 6 is arranged, can slow down the impact velocity of rivers, reduce the harm that erodees and bring, upper platform 4 is provided with upper guard band 9, lower platform 8 is provided with lower guard band 11, be provided with firm guard band 10 on the buffering platform 6, upper platform 4, lower platform 8 and all be provided with tree planting hole 17 on buffering platform 6, it has coarse stone 19 to fill in the tree planting hole 17, plant the tree in the tree planting hole 17, the inside water and soil is stable to protect, pack coarse stone 19 in the hole, can protect surface structure's water and soil, the splice of concrete brick layer 3 is provided with planting hole 18, through planting hole 18, plant small-size plant, the afforestation is better, plant the vine in the planting hole 18 on first slope 5 and the second slope 7, the vine covers in the slope outside, have better afforestation effect, plant tree 12 and shrub plant 13 in upper guard band 9, plant 12 in firm guard band 10, herbaceous plant 14 and shrub plant 13 plant tree plant 12 and herbaceous plant 14 in lower guard band 11, to different topography, plant different plants, can effectively carry out hydrologic cycle, promote ecological development, the material of the concrete brick 15 in the concrete brick layer 3 sets up to infiltration concrete, infiltration concrete can improve the gas permeability and the infiltration nature of soil basic unit 1 for soil basic unit 1 is aerobic environment, maintains normal ecology, and concrete brick 15 sets up to octagonal structure, is provided with guiding gutter 16 on the concrete brick 15, through setting up guiding gutter 16, can send too much rainwater underground through planting the hole.
Therefore, the ecological protection slope adopting the structure disclosed by the utility model keeps the stability of water and soil through the root system of plants, and the planting holes and the water seepage concrete bricks are arranged to ensure the air permeability and the water permeability of the soil base layer, so that the inside of the soil base layer maintains the normal ecological environment, and the effect of protecting the slope is effectively achieved.
